| Dimension | Details |
|---|---|
| Standard Compliance | Must meet NFPA 80 standards for fire doors. |
| Installation Location | Installed in openings between areas of different fire ratings. |
| Testing Frequency | Annual inspections and testing required. |
| Clearance Requirements | Minimum clearance of 1/16 inch around the door panel. |
| Hardware Standards | Use of listed and labeled hardware is essential. |
| Maintenance Frequency | Quarterly maintenance recommended for optimal performance. |
| Fire Rating Duration | Common ratings include 20, 45, 60, and 90 minutes. |
| Emergency Operation | Must be operable from both sides in case of emergency. |

When installing, ensure the door tracks are aligned and free of debris. Use a level to check the alignment, and tighten all fittings securely. Many failures occur due to loose hardware. According to industry reports, 20% of fire doors do not operate correctly due to improper installation. Regular testing and maintenance are essential. Inspect the door’s mechanism frequently.
Consider the environment where the door will be installed. Humidity and temperature can affect the door’s performance. Avoid placing the door in areas prone to excessive moisture. This can lead to corrosion and malfunction. It's worth noting that overlooking such details can compromise safety and efficiency during a fire. When installing roll down fire doors, avoiding common mistakes is crucial for safety. One frequent error is improper measurement. Ensure the opening dimensions are accurate before purchasing a door. A poor fit can compromise the door’s effectiveness. Also, misaligning the tracks can prevent the door from functioning correctly.
Another mistake is neglecting to check the door's weight. Fire doors have specific weight requirements. If the door is too heavy for the frame, it may fall during an emergency. Installers often overlook this detail. Ensure that your structure can support the weight of the fire door.
